Moscow petrol stations cap sales at 30 litres per vehicle amid shortage
Petrol stations in Moscow have capped fuel sales at around 30 litres per vehicle due to shortages, Reuters reported. Russian oil infrastructure has been under sustained Ukrainian military attack for months. President Vladimir Putin claimed on Wednesday that the strikes have not caused critical damage and that the situation remains under control.
